A Time Synchronization Technique for CoAP-based Home Automation Systems

被引:25
作者
Son, Seung-Chul [1 ]
Kim, Nak-Woo [1 ]
Lee, Byung-Tak [1 ]
Cho, Chae Ho [2 ]
Chong, Jo Woon [3 ]
机构
[1] IT Management Device Serv Team, Elect & Telecommun Res Inst, Gwangju, South Korea
[2] M2Soft Co Ltd, Seoul, South Korea
[3] Worcester Polytech Inst, Worcester, MA 01609 USA
关键词
home automation; smart home; time synchronization; CoAP;
D O I
10.1109/TCE.2016.7448557
中图分类号
TM [电工技术]; TN [电子技术、通信技术];
学科分类号
0808 ; 0809 ;
摘要
With the advent of internet-of-things (IoT)-based home automation systems, time synchronization techniques for low power sensor modules are in high demand. The constrained application protocol (CoAP) was recently standardized for sensor networks by IETF and is becoming widely adopted for home automation systems by ETSI, OMA, and oneM2M. The network time protocol (NTP) is not applicable to home automation systems due to its limited computing resources. This paper proposes a lightweight time synchronization algorithm for CoAP-based home automation system networks. The CoAP option field and a shim header are used to include time-stamps in the home automation system. The proposed scheme can thus be applied to both IP-based and non-IP-based home automation systems. In experiments with several household devices having non-IP communication interfaces, experimental results show that the proposed technique gives an average error of 1 ms and a network overhead reduction of 17% when compared to the ideal NTP service.
引用
收藏
页码:10 / 16
页数:7
相关论文
共 16 条
[1]  
[Anonymous], 2004, Proceedings of International Conference on Embedded Networked Sensor Systems (Sensys), DOI DOI 10.1145/1031495.1031501
[2]  
[Anonymous], 2003, Proceedings of the 1st International Conference on Embedded Networks Sensor Systems (SenSys'03), DOI DOI 10.1145/958491.958508
[3]  
[Anonymous], 2014, 7252 IETF
[4]  
Bergmann O., 2012, 2012 International Conference on Computing, Networking and Communications (ICNC), P446, DOI 10.1109/ICCNC.2012.6167461
[5]   Fine-grained network time synchronization using reference broadcasts [J].
Elson, J ;
Girod, L ;
Estrin, D .
USENIX ASSOCIATION PROCEEDINGS OF THE FIFTH SYMPOSIUM ON OPERATING SYSTEMS DESIGN AND IMPLEMENTATION, 2002, :147-163
[6]  
Haijun Gu, 2011, 2011 International Conference on Electronic & Mechanical Engineering and Information Technology (EMEIT 2011), P3919, DOI 10.1109/EMEIT.2011.6023915
[7]   More Efficient Home Energy Management System Based on ZigBee Communication and Infrared Remote Controls [J].
Han, Jinsoo ;
Choi, Chang-Sic ;
Lee, Ilwoo .
IEEE TRANSACTIONS ON CONSUMER ELECTRONICS, 2011, 57 (01) :85-89
[8]  
Hwang S, 2005, LECT NOTES COMPUT SC, V3741, P105
[9]   Smart Heating and Air Conditioning Scheduling Method Incorporating Customer Convenience for Home Energy Management System [J].
Jo, Hyung-Chul ;
Kim, Sangwon ;
Joo, Sung-Kwan .
IEEE TRANSACTIONS ON CONSUMER ELECTRONICS, 2013, 59 (02) :316-322
[10]   Design and evaluation of a wireless sensor network architecture for urgent information transmission [J].
Kawai, Tetsuya ;
Wakamiya, Naoki ;
Murata, Masayuki .
INTERNATIONAL JOURNAL OF SENSOR NETWORKS, 2009, 6 (02) :101-114